Review on πŸ’‘ APC PE6U21 Desk Mount Power Station - U-Shaped Surge Protector with USB Ports (3), Desk Clamp, 6 Outlet, 1080 Joules, Black by Alan Massey

Revainrating 1 out of 5

Beware! 3 Devices: All broken switches after 3-4 months of daily use

It looked like a good way to put the main switch on the table and there was a mess of wires underneath. The mount was also pretty solid. I use it daily to turn off my monitor/computer/speakers to avoid low power consumption. I've used 3 of these surge protectors before and all 3 failed the same way (2 devices with USB A + USB C and 1 device with USB A only). The switch has failed on every unit I've had - they all started making electrical noises, buzzing, crackling, or shorting out after about 4-5 months of daily use. I contacted the manufacturer and they sent a replacement after my first purchase. Then the replacement failed a few months later. I then bought a 3rd unit thinking maybe I was just unlucky and it also failed in the same way. These things appear to have either very poor quality parts or terrible production/quality control. Despite good customer service (they sent a replacement after my first purchase) I don't want to risk my electronics on this junk.
